我購買了三個月的免費試用版Google雲端伺服器,我從其他地方購買了網域。但我的網站還沒上線。谷歌顯示“無法訪問此網站”,我發現了這個“DNS_PROBE_FINISHED_NXDOMAIN“.我該如何解決我的問題?
答案1
您需要分配一個一個記錄如下...
- 主機名稱:空白或@(根據網域註冊商)
- 答案/IP:您的 Google 運算 IP
- TTL:通常為 3600(1 小時)秒,但可以設定得更低以加快速度(您可能無法將其設定為低於 300 秒)。
現在只需等待 4 到 12 小時,它就會起作用。
答案2
a) 你需要創建一個GCP DNS 中的公共區域
b) 之後,您應該將 DNS 權限從目前 DNS 委託給 GCP Cloud DNS。
前往您購買域名的地方。
b.1) 選擇您的網域。 b.2) 點選 DNS 部分。 b.3) 選擇「使用自訂名稱伺服器」或類似選項,並在建立區域名稱時使用 GCP Cloud DNS 註冊商提供的 NS 更新欄位。這只是一個例子,字母可以是a、b、c、d、e,數字可以是1、2、3、4。 ns-cloud-b1.googledomains.com。 ns-cloud-b2.googledomains.com。 ns-cloud-b3.googledomains.com。 ns-cloud-b4.googledomains.com。
c) 一旦您將 DNS 權威委託給 GCP,請在您已正確委託 DNS 時在此處進行檢查 [1]。答案一定是上面的NS。
https://www.whatsmydns.net/#NS/"這裡你的域名”
d) 在 GCP 中,您需要定義一個允許存取網頁瀏覽的防火牆規則
用於允許對應連接埠(通常為 80,此處為建立防火牆規則的指南)中的 VM 執行個體的流量的防火牆規則。
使用 TCP/80 協定/連接埠。
e) 就這樣。
之後,您只需要等待網路上的完整傳播。通常需要 24 小時左右。
我希望這些冗長的說明可以幫助您實現目標。
希望您度過愉快的一天並保持安全!